Output 587192e5386cdeea946144ef46ca69b515995fd4367ed1d5dcbcea56d9ff82e6:4

value
7660320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ed84ec0bd2f3d3670e95d1e3df477cb55c77a56f OP_EQUAL
address
MVZ3cUp3cfoxZLUXEBgRVuEnhYbuxGt9iV
transaction
587192e5386cdeea946144ef46ca69b515995fd4367ed1d5dcbcea56d9ff82e6
spent
true